&lt;p&gt;A show lets out at the Los Angeles Theater.  The &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.laconservancy.org/&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ow&quot;&gt;Los Angeles Conservancy&lt;/a&gt;'s annual Last Remaining Seats movie series hosts movies in some of the old theaters in the downtown Broadway Theater district.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The crowd motion comes from a 10 second exposure.  I've combined it with some much shorter exposures taken a few minutes earlier to preserve details in the lights.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
This is one of the few instances where I visualized the shot I wanted days beforehand, I was able to take the shot, and the result was about what I expected.  That's not how it usually works for me.  My normal procedure is to (a) arrive with no idea of what to shoot, (b) come up with a concept for a shot, then discover that the composition I envision is geometrically impossible, dummy, and (c) fail to notice obvious problems when I do shoot.  Consequently, the keepers are almost never the ones I expect.  (Follow these simple steps and you too can be an Unprofessional Photographer like me!)&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Tokina 11-16mm @ 11mm, f/10, ISO 200, exposures from 10 sec to about 1/4 sec.&lt;/p&gt;</description>

&lt;p&gt;This is inside Cathédrale Saints-Michel-et-Gudule in Brussels, Belgium.  You can also see the windows on the &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.flickr.com/photos/magneticlobster/4635180305/&quot;&gt;other side&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Processing this one took a bit of work because the windows are so much brighter than everything else, and I wanted the inside of the church to be clearly visible but still retain some of the detail in the windows.  I ended up doing two separate tonemappings, one for the windows and another for everything else, then merging/blending the results (among other tweaks).&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
I wish there were a way to stitch together several photographs to get an unobstructed view of all of these windows in the same shot.  Basically I want to put the side of the church in a giant flatbed scanner.&lt;/p&gt;</description>
